This is the photograph that truly got me hooked on astrophotography. It was taken in early February 2018.

It was captured, as they say, "on a whim." I didn't have my own camera back then; I was shooting with an acquaintance named Nikolai, a big fan of experimenting with exposure time and ISO.

In short, this is a mix of frames with exposures from 1 second to 25 seconds and ISO from 400 to 6400. Most, however, are 15 seconds at ISO 4000.

Minimal processing: DSS and a little bit of FS.
